    Normal Measurement worksheets designed for 5-Year-Olds serve as a crucial educational tool in laying the foundation for a child's understanding of basic measurement concepts. These worksheets are tailored specifically to the developmental stage of 5-year-old children, making them an ideal resource for engaging young learners in the world of measurement.

    The primary usefulness of Normal Measurement worksheets for 5-Year-Olds lies in their ability to introduce concepts such as length, height, weight, and volume in a fun and interactive way. By integrating these worksheets into their learning routine, children can gradually grasp the importance and application of measurement in their daily lives. This not only enhances their mathematical skills but also encourages curiosity and critical thinking.

    Moreover, these worksheets are designed to be age-appropriate, with activities that challenge yet do not overwhelm. They often include colorful illustrations and simple instructions that ensure young learners can work independently or with minimal guidance. This boosts their confidence and fosters a positive attitude toward learning.

    Additionally, Normal Measurement worksheets for 5-Year-Olds offer a structured approach to learning measurement. By systematically progressing through these worksheets, children can build their skills incrementally, ensuring a solid understanding of fundamental measurement concepts. This structured progression is crucial for young learners as it aids in retaining information and applying it both in academic settings and in everyday situations.

    In summary, Normal Measurement worksheets for 5-Year-Olds are an invaluable educational resource. They make learning measurement concepts accessible, engaging, and enjoyable for young children, setting a strong foundation for future mathematical learning.
